Nawa
Town
Nawa is a city in southern Syria, administratively belonging to the Daraa Governorate. It has an altitude of 563 meters. According to the Syria Central Bureau of Statistics, Nawa had a population of 47,066 in the 2004 census. Nawa is situated 7 km north of Sihām Z̧ahr al Ḩimār.
Tasil
Town
Tasil is a town in southern Syria, administratively part of the Izraa District of the Daraa Governorate. Nearby localities include Nawa to the northeast, Adwan and al-Shaykh Saad to the east, Jalin and Tafas to the south, Saham al-Jawlan to the southwest and Saida and the Golan Heights to the west. Tasil is situated 7 km west of Sihām Z̧ahr al Ḩimār.
